Latest Patents

Mita's latest patents include an information processing device and a method for assigning tasks. This invention involves a computer that calculates memory access rates for various tasks based on hardware monitor information. The tasks are linked to specific syntax units in an application program. The computer assigns tasks to processor sockets based on these calculated memory access rates. Another significant patent is a compile processing apparatus and method. This apparatus compiles programs consisting of multiple classes with initializing procedures. It includes a specifying unit that identifies initializing procedures when required, a determination unit that assesses whether these procedures affect other classes, and a changing unit that modifies statements to prevent access to the initializing procedures when deemed unnecessary.
